Magnetic circular dichroism of LaMn1-xAlxO3+δ series of samples

Description

We report magnetic circular dichroism (MCD) studies on the polycrystalline LaMn1-xAlxO3+δ series with x=0-0.2. The Mn-2p MCD was recorded in the temperature range from 45 to 300 K for samples with x=0, 0.075, 0.1 and 0.15. It was seen that unlike ac-susceptibility no second transition in MCD was observed at lower temperatures in the samples with x≥0.075 indicating that it is not intrinsic to the samples but arise out of the dynamics of ferromagnetic clusters in the polycrystalline sample. More significantly, the MCD signal persists even 100 K above the ferromagnetic TC confirming that the observation of the magnetic correlation above TC in bulk measurement is intrinsic to this type of systems
